Policy Forum on International Security Issues is the UK based and registered company (No 4999110) which is a neocon propaganda operation linked to the US registered Policy Forum on International Security Affairs.

On 15 October 2007 the Directors of the company applied to have it struck off the register on the basis that, among other things, it had not 'traded or otherwise carried on business or changed its name'[1]
